Three Players Who Have The Opportunity To Help Barca To Silverware

Injuries have really mounted up for Barcelona this season, with both Luis Suarez and Ousmane Dembele out until May after the very earliest.

The setbacks to two of Barca’s major stars have opened the door for others to shine in their absence. Here is a look at three players who could take that opportunity and help them lift silverware at the end of the campaign.

Martin Braithwaite

La Liga gave Barcelona permission to make an emergency signing in February due to injuries to their forward players and they opted to sign Martin Braithwaite for 18 million euros from fellow Spanish side Leganes.

Barca could only sign a player in Spain, therefore, their options were limited. They chose Braithwaite who has signed a contract to remain at Camp Nou until June 2024.

It is some rise for the Denmark international as last season he featured for Middlesbrough in the Championship in England where he scored just three goals in 17 appearances.

Braithwaite has netted eight times in 27 games for Leganes so far this season. His tally is likely to significantly improve now given the quality of players in his new side.

The loss of Suarez and Dembele allows Braithwaite to complete his dream of playing for the Spanish giants. He will be hoping he can go one step further now by scoring the goals which will see Barcelona have domestic success this season.

Frenkie de Jong

Barcelona made the decision to loan Phillipe Coutinho to Bayern Munich until the end of the season back in the summer. They may just be regretting that decision now as the Brazilian has shone for the German champions who are odds-on at 4/9 in the Bundesliga betting to defend their title.

Coutinho’s absence meant even more was expected from summer signing Frenkie de Jong. The Dutchman has really impressed over the last couple of months, showing why Barca splashed out 75m Euros for his services back in July.

The 22-year-old is an incredible talent and despite his young age, he already has experience in the Champions League which is going to be important. Barca have not lifted the trophy in the premier European competition since 2015 so they will be hoping to put that right this year.

Ansu Fati

At less than 17 years old, Ansu Fati became the second youngest player to feature for Barcelona when he made his debut in La Liga against Real Betis. Since then, the Spanish-born winger has been given more opportunities to shine on the pitch and he has not disappointed.

Fati scored his first brace for Barca in their 2-1 victory over Levante on the 2nd February. He was also crucial for Quique Setien when he scored the winning goal in his side’s victory over Inter Milan in the Champions League back in December.

There is no doubt Fati is going to be a huge star in the future. He is taking full advantage of the playing time this season where he is using it to develop and prove his talent.

It would be no surprise if Barcelona are celebrating multiple trophies in May, which will be a credit to the players who have stepped in to pick up the reins.
